Kenya is Africa’s Avocado King!
Morocco may have gained ground in exports to Europe due to logistical challenges Kenya faced last year — but the bigger picture tells a different story.
Kenya’s avocado hectarage has expanded beyond 36,000 hectares, compared to Morocco’s approximately 12,000 hectares. When you consider total export markets — including Kenya’s strong and growing trade with the UAE and other global destinations — Kenya continues to lead in overall avocado exports and industry development.
Even more exciting is the rapid transformation of Kenya’s avocado sector through diversification and value addition:
Kenya has nearly tripled avocado oil exports in the past year, approaching 30,000 Metric Tonnes.Over 50 avocado oil processing plants are now operational across the country. Kenya has evolved into a regional processing hub, trucking and crushing fruit from across East Africa, New guacamole processing facilities are coming online, expanding product diversification. Investment in frozen avocado processing plants is accelerating, strengthening Kenya’s position in global value-added markets.
This is the evolution of Kenya’s avocado industry — moving beyond fresh exports into processing, innovation, and regional leadership.
